Web5 okt. 2024 · Where, M is Ca2+ and Mg2+ present in water. Reaction (1) can be carried out quantitatively at. pH 10 using Eriochrome Black T (EBT) as indicator. EBT forms a wine-red complex with. M2+ ions which is relatively less stable than the M2+-EDTA complex. On titration, EDTA first. reacts with free M2+ ions and then with the metal-EBT indicator …

Web4 apr. 2024 · titration, process of chemical analysis in which the quantity of some constituent of a sample is determined by adding to the measured sample an exactly known quantity of another substance with which the desired constituent reacts in a definite, known proportion.
